Arca CIO Predicts Memecoin Decline with Rise of Real-World Asset Tokens
- Jeff Dorman, CIO at Arca, suggests memecoins may lose popularity if real-world asset tokens are widely issued.
- Dorman highlights potential growth sectors: SOL, DeFi (RAY, AERO, HYPE, JUP, AAVE), AI agents.
- He proposes shorting memecoins as real-world asset tokens gain traction.
- Dorman outlines uses for tokens by entities like universities and cities to add value.
- Mark Cuban questioned the utility of such tokens for buyers.
According to Jeff Dorman of Arca, the future issuance of tokens tied to real-world assets could lead to a decline in the popularity of memecoins as investors shift focus to more utility-driven digital assets.
